(a)Except as provided in Sections 68097.1 to 68097.8, inclusive, of the Government Code , the service of a subpoena is made by delivering a copy, or a ticket containing its substance, to the witness personally, giving or offering to the witness at the same time, if demanded by him or her, the fees to which he or she is entitled for travel to and from the place designated, and one days attendance there. Within 14 days of service of a subpoena to permit inspection and copying of documents, the person subpoenaed may serve a written objection. A third party that has received a subpoena for production of documents may respond with written objections, which must state the legal basis for objecting to each request. One example is when the specified documents are privileged. (b)Prior to the date called for in the subpoena duces tecum for the production of personal records, the subpoenaing party shall serve or cause to be served on the consumer whose records are being sought a copy of the subpoena duces tecum, of the affidavit supporting the issuance of the subpoena, if any, and of the notice described in subdivision (e), and proof of service as indicated in paragraph (1) of subdivision (c). (g)Any consumer whose personal records are sought by a subpoena duces tecum and who is a party to the civil action in which this subpoena duces tecum is served may, prior to the date for production, bring a motion under Section 1987.1 to quash or modify the subpoena duces tecum.
